Dock Seals & Shelters
Seals and Shelters keep the elements out for a safe and productive dock environment. We offer seals, shelters and combination products. The seals provide insulation from the weather. The shelters provide superior accessibility. The combination of products provide the insulating benefits of a dock seal plus the full accessibility of a shelter. Pioneer PF Series Head Curtain Dock Seals

Printer Friendly
Pressure treated lumber and full yellow guide stripes are standard with all Pioneer Deck Seals. Optional features and equipment include:
1) galvanized metal hood for overhead protection of seals and flexible shelters
2) blockouts for extra protection when full projection foam is not desirable
3) larger head pad height for higher doors and truck heights
4) tapered units for inclined or declined truck approaches
5) wear shingles to add years of life to seals

Additional Information
Non sagging head curtain design utilizes 3/4" galvanized pipe for front edge support
Hybrid design head curtain with foam layer (4" or 1") on curtain plus optional extra fabric cover
Custom design available for special sealing needs
Highly effective for doors of oversize height
Weather tight enclosure for maximum energy savings
Fabric weight protection from 40 to 140 oz.
Pressure treated wood backing
Steel backing optional
Pioneer R Series Rigid Frame Shelters

Additional Information
Raked cut header on all rigid wood frame models prevents water from standing on top
Heavy duty structural channel support/protective bumpers with rigid type units
Overlapping weather shingles on head curtains
Side and head curtain wiper action allows full access to rear of truck
Face curtains on rigid type include scotch ply fiberglass stays and yellow guide stripes
6oz. translucent white fiberglass top cover
Side covers translucent 28 oz. P.V.C. base fabric or 6 oz. translucent fiberglass
